Full stack development with Python: the standard route into Technopark product teams

If your aim is a developer job in this city, this is the most direct path on offer. Technopark Kazhakkoottam is the largest IT park in Kerala with something in the region of 470 companies, and the single largest category of vacancy across them is a software engineer who can build and ship a web application. Python with Django or FastAPI on the server, React on the front end, PostgreSQL underneath, Git and Docker around it — that combination appears in an enormous share of local job descriptions. Our batches are mostly B.Tech graduates from College of Engineering Trivandrum, Government Engineering College Barton Hill, Marian, Loyola and other Kerala University colleges, MCA holders, and a steady group of self-taught developers who can build things but keep failing the structured interview.

Who hires for this in and around Trivandrum

Product companies at Technopark hiring for their own platforms, which is generally the most interesting work available locally. IT services firms on campus and at Infopark Kochi staffing client projects, which hire in the largest volume and are the most realistic first employer for a fresher. Startups around Technopark and the state startup ecosystem, offering wide exposure and less stability. Agencies and smaller studios across the city building applications for clients. There is also a growing freelance and contract layer, since a developer in Trivandrum can serve customers anywhere; several of our alumni have built that into a full income, though it is a harder start than employment. Technocity at the northern end of the corridor continues to expand the same demand. Fresher salaries here are lower than Bengaluru for identical work — that gap is real and worth planning around — but the cost of living difference and the option of staying near family is why most of our learners choose to stay.

How local hiring actually screens candidates

Almost every process runs the same three gates. A coding round on data structures and problem solving, usually online and timed. A technical discussion of your own project, where interviewers dig into decisions you made and will notice immediately if you cannot explain your own code. And a practical round on the fundamentals sitting behind the framework — how HTTP works, what an index does to a query, how authentication and sessions are handled, what happens when two requests write the same row.

So the course drills all three. You build several applications from an empty folder to a deployed URL, with database design, REST APIs, authentication, testing and deployment done properly rather than skipped. Problem-solving practice runs alongside from the first week, because that is the gate most graduates fail. Code is reviewed by working developers, and mock interviews are run in the same format the Technopark panels use.
